7.6.2 Compensatory 'nme <br /> <br /> Upon request, employees shall be compensated for such overtime in <br /> compensatory time off. An employee's compensatory time off <br /> balance shall not exceed seventy-two (72) hours at any given time. <br /> <br /> 7.6.3 Hire Back Procedures <br /> <br /> The Hire Back procedures will be included in the Operations Manual, <br /> as amended effective May 1, 2002. Any changes to the Hire Back <br /> procedures will be by meet and confer. <br /> <br />7.7 Paramedic Pay <br /> <br /> 1) Paramedic Premium Pay for paramedics - 10% of Base Pay. <br /> <br /> 2) Effective the first pay period on or after May 25, 1998, for all other <br /> firefighters including captains: Paramedic Assistance Pay - 2.5% of Base <br /> Pay. <br /> <br /> 3) FF/P's receiving Paramedic Pay will not receive Paramedic Assistance Pay. <br /> <br /> Paramedic Pay will be added to base pay, regardless of position on engine <br /> or if on scheduled or non-scheduled hours. <br /> <br /> 5) Paramedic Pay will only be paid to FF/P's functioning in department <br /> approved Paramedic positions. <br /> <br /> 6) FF/P's will maintain Paramedic Pay when acting in higher classification. <br /> <br /> 7) A training allowance of $10,000 will be provided, in lieu of overtime pay <br /> while attending off duty training for those Firefighters attending the <br /> paramedic training program approved by the City. This $[0,000 Training <br /> Allowance will be provided as follows: $2,500 upon acceptance into the <br /> Training Program as determined by examination and seniority; $2,500 upon <br /> successful completion of the didatic training; $2,500 upon successful <br /> completion of clinical training; $2,500 upon receipt of Paramedic <br /> Certification by the State of California and the County of San Mateo. <br /> <br /> 8) [f an employee voluntarily withdraws from any portion of the Paramedic <br /> Training Program, the employee shall refund to the City the most recent <br /> $2,500 received. Rre Management shall be responsible to notify HR and <br /> Finance Departments regarding the refund. <br /> <br /> 9) The above provisions regarding captain compaction and paramedic pay <br /> supercede the provisions of the sideletter dated August :ta,, :t997.
